Transaction 21d56860b88ab86de46b343a5f003645704c2d4b1777fe9f2a9a81f694b09d91
1 Input
1 Output
-
21d56860b88ab86de46b343a5f003645704c2d4b1777fe9f2a9a81f694b09d91:0
- value
- 1201038
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ad371073ffecf46b0370173d464b97887c7c1980 OP_EQUAL
- address
- 3HUtnfQV6Ew1s12KtipsKCkkkWTad3vBFy